    Challenger Rear Drawer Setup

    Hi,

    Looking at getting a rear drawer setup for the PB shortly. Have been looking at the lightweight ORS drawers, mate of mine has then and they are rock solid. Just wondering if anyone else has a setup yet as I don't believe many of the manufactures make them for this car yet. Would love to see some pics etc of a finished product. Goal is to put the drawers in and a fridge slide ontop, and then a plastic water tank 40-60L behind the drawer setup and the rear seats all tucked away nice and neatly.

                  how do u guys go accessing the spare wheel now u have drawers installed??

                  Comment

                  • pavloh
                    Member
                    • Aug 2010
                    • 52
                    • Sydney

                    #10
                    There is an empty section between the 2 drawers which has a removable carpeted lid. Once removed a socket extension tool I guess I would need to use to undo the spare wheel. What is really good though all that extra space between the 2 drawers and against the sides of the boot is all usable space with removable lids.
